Cloudflare Tunnel部署指南:将您的树莓派服务推向互联网
2023-08-15 19:53:55
探索 Cloudflare Tunnel:将您的内网服务安全地连接到互联网
在当今互联的世界中,需要将内网服务暴露给互联网的情况越来越普遍。然而,直接公开这些服务会带来重大的安全风险。Cloudflare Tunnel 是一款革命性的工具,它解决了这一挑战,提供了一种安全可靠的方法来实现内网穿透。
Cloudflare Tunnel 的优势
1. 开源且免费: Cloudflare Tunnel 是开源软件,可供所有人免费使用,使每个人都能享受其强大的功能。
2. 易于使用: 即使对于初学者来说,Cloudflare Tunnel 也非常易于设置和使用。其直观的界面和清晰的文档消除了复杂性。
3. 安全可靠: Cloudflare Tunnel 采用了强大的安全措施,包括 SSL 加密和防火墙保护,以保护您的内网服务免受攻击。
4. 全球可用: Cloudflare Tunnel 的全球网络使其可在世界任何地方使用,确保您无论身处何处都可以访问您的服务。
在树莓派上设置 Cloudflare Tunnel
步骤 1:准备工作
- 树莓派
- Cloudflare 账户
- 域名
- Cloudflare Tunnel 客户端
步骤 2:安装 Cloudflare Tunnel 客户端
从 Cloudflare Tunnel 官方网站下载客户端并将其安装在您的树莓派上。
步骤 3:创建 Cloudflare Tunnel
在 Cloudflare 仪表盘中创建新的隧道,选择一个域名和子域。
步骤 4:配置 Cloudflare Tunnel
指定您要暴露的内网服务及其端口号。
步骤 5:测试 Cloudflare Tunnel
使用浏览器或 curl 命令测试连接,查看您是否可以访问内网服务。
步骤 6:使用 Cloudflare Tunnel
现在,您的内网服务已经安全地暴露在互联网上,您可以使用任何连接方式进行访问。
Cloudflare Tunnel 的好处
1. 远程访问: Cloudflare Tunnel 使您可以从任何地方远程访问您的内网服务,从而提高了便利性和灵活性。
2. 安全地共享服务: 您可以安全地与团队成员、客户或合作伙伴共享您的服务,同时保持其安全性。
3. 开发和测试: Cloudflare Tunnel 为开发和测试提供了一个隔离且安全的环境,无需公开您的服务。
4. 提高性能: Cloudflare Tunnel 利用 Cloudflare 的全球网络,优化连接并提高内网服务的速度。
常见问题解答
1. Cloudflare Tunnel 与 VPN 有什么区别?
Cloudflare Tunnel 是一个轻量级解决方案,专注于连接特定服务,而 VPN 提供对整个网络的访问。
2. Cloudflare Tunnel 是如何免费的?
Cloudflare Tunnel 的基本功能是免费的,但高级功能,例如自定义域名和带宽上限,需要付费订阅。
3. 我需要了解哪些技术才能使用 Cloudflare Tunnel?
基本的技术知识就足够了。Cloudflare 提供了全面的文档和教程,使设置和使用变得容易。
4. Cloudflare Tunnel 是否安全?
是的,Cloudflare Tunnel 采用了行业领先的安全措施,包括 SSL 加密和防火墙保护,以保护您的服务。
5. 我可以在哪里获得帮助?
Cloudflare 提供广泛的帮助资源,包括文档、论坛和技术支持,以解决任何问题或疑问。
结论
Cloudflare Tunnel 是一款功能强大的工具,使您能够安全、轻松地将内网服务暴露给互联网。其开源性质、易用性和强大的安全功能使其成为希望在不影响安全性或便利性的情况下连接服务的个人和企业的一个绝佳选择。通过利用 Cloudflare Tunnel,您可以解锁远程访问、安全共享和提高性能等众多优势,从而将您的内网服务提升到一个新的水平。